What is The Eraser about?

Visions of characters by the seaside from one's memory are erased by the filmmaker's hand.

What does the cinematography of The Eraser look like?

Sampled across 123 frames, the coverage of The Eraser leans on medium shots (47% of the sample) and close-ups (35%). Cinematographer Tatsuo Suzuki keeps 44% of it in soft, low-key light. Night and dusk account for 54% of the frames. Anamorphic glass shapes the frame. Focus stays shallow in 76% of the frames, isolating subjects from their surroundings.
